Today we unpack how you can apply systems thinking in your startup and build high-value 'systems. You get the three-question framework for mapping workflows, cutting noise, and focusing on the high-value steps and how we've applied it at Zipline.io!


The few chapters

    • Defining a “system” and why complexity naturally creeps in
    • Mapping your core workflows as “arteries” and spotting the noisy “capillaries”

    • The three essential questions to evaluate any process:

      1. What’s the goal?

      2. How frequently does it run?

      3. How much waste or risk is in the flow?

    • Real-world examples in recruitment and finance on pruning unnecessary steps

    • Practical tactics for trimming complexity and building lean, scalable operations
